Key Responsibilities

  • •Bring partner marketing campaigns and program components to life across email, webinars, events, and co-branded assets.
  • •Coordinate campaign briefs, copy drafts, registration details, execution checklists, and related materials for partner launches.
  • •Support partner communications and maintain partner-facing content and resources across portals and enablement systems.
  • •Track engagement and performance metrics, prepare updates for partner managers and stakeholders, and document results.
  • •Recommend improvements to campaign execution, reporting, content organization, and workflows; use AI to accelerate drafts and reporting with review and tailoring.

Company Brief

Seeq
Develops advanced analytics software for process manufacturing and industrial operations, enabling engineers and analysts to rapidly investigate, collaborate on, and derive insights from time-series process data to improve production performance and reliability.
